[quote=Anonymous] Sidwell upper school kids often have four hours of homework per night if they're taking strenuous classes. They also work on homework during the weekends. Fortunately my son who graduated several years ago needed very little sleep. He was able to participate in afterschool activities but it made meant that he had to stay up until at least midnight every night or almost every night doing homework. He thrive there and was able to deal with the stress. But we did not send our second son there because he needs more sleep and more time to do extracurricular activities. I can understand A parent looking for a school that's less homework laden[/quote]
